Anyhow as the name suggest, A close friend of mine is opening up a storefront In my area. He is also trying to sell whats in the store online.
As of right now how would one go about that. Do you need special software or just normal HTML, with a CC linky.

The absolute easiest way to do this is A) Ebay Store, B) Yahoo store....they do all the web work for you all you gotta do is list the items you want to sell

If you have someone that has small web experiance you can downlaod this open source project. It really easy to install and setup.

http://oscommerce.com
